The GAA have ordered New York County Board to immediately cease all work on the redevelopment of Gaelic Park.

Croke Park sent an email to the board’s executive on Tuesday to stop construction work at the venue in The Bronx. It is understood New York GAA have obliged and the contractors JJ Matthews are currently off site.
